MTA-C Series Cup Forming, Filling and Sealing
Machine overview
Versatile cup forming, filling and sealing solution.
Cup forming, filling and sealing machines with a high degree of standardisation for low to medium capacity. Equipped for a large range of cup designs in all packaging material types. Nominal output ranges up to 28,800 cups/h according to cup type and size. Available in clean, and ultra-clean execution.
The machines of the MTA-C Series are mainly used in the dairy industry.

Technical information
| TECHNICAL DATA MTA-C Series | |||
| Material width | max. 578 mm | Draw-off length | max. 250 mm |
| Cup size range | 20-500 ml | Forming depth | max. 100 mm |
| TYPICAL MATERIALS | |||
| PET, PP, PP Multilayer, PLA, PS, PS Multilayer, PVC | |||
| TYPICAL OUTPUT RANGE AND APPLICATION EXAMPLES | |||
| Range | 28,800 cups/h | ||
| STANDARD EQUIPMENT | |||
| Control System | Controller and servomotors: Siemens PLC | ||
| Reel diameters | Plastic reel Ø 1.200 mm, Lid reel Ø 300 mm, Label reel Ø 600 mm | ||
| Punching principles | Single cup with grid, single cup low waste, multi-format with different punching configurations | ||
| Hygiene class | Clean* | ||
| OPTIONS | |||
| Bottom web | 2nd reel for flying reel change | ||
| Lid material | 2nd reel and/or 2nd reel with magazine for flying reel change | ||
| Dosing system | 2 fillers (pre-/post fill) | ||
| Hygiene class | Ultra-clean (VDMA III+IV) | ||
| Cup discharge and secondary packaging | Walking beam, pick & place systems or other end-of-line equipment | ||
* Depending on customer specification
